The Reeves Scholars Program (RSP) is a global community of future educators working together to become the best educators they can be and make an impact in their classrooms, their communities, and the world.

Students in the RSP will spend the academic year working together in a small learning community of MSU Teacher Education students and Teacher Education students from the University of Cape Coast Ghana. We will learn together both in person and virtually, developing our skills and dispositions as educators, community leaders, and difference makers.

Reeves Scholars will develop leadership skills, grow as educators, and make new friends and colleagues at MSU, in Ghana, and in area schools and communities.

Eligibility

In order to be eligible for the program, students must be:

  • Admitted to MSU’s teacher preparation program.
  • Able to meet the program requirements listed below which includes travel to Ghana in May 2021 and successfully completing two 1-credit program seminars in fall 2020 and spring 2021 semesters.

Program Structure and Requirements

Each year the RSP will admit 5 MSU Reeves Scholars for the academic year. Program requirements include:

  • Registering for and successfully completing the requirements for the two 1-credit RSP seminars (Fall and Spring semesters).
  • Engaging in extended learning activities with Reeves Scholars from the University of Cape Coast when they visit MSU fall semester 2020.
  • Completing in-country requirements for the two-week program in Ghana in May 2021.

Program Cost

Program Fee: $2,500
The program fee will include:

  • Airfare to/from Ghana
  • Lodging in Ghana
  • Most meals
  • Group activities
  • International insurance
  • Local transportation
  • Local admissions and fees

Estimated Additional (out-of-pocket) expenses

  • Additional meals: $300
  • Passport: $150
  • Visa: $250
  • Spending money in Ghana: $500
  • Books and materials for seminar courses: $200
